Janson Launches Russian Drama Series Gogol on Amazon Prime Video

Janson Media today announced the release of the historical drama series, Gogol, on Amazon Prime Video in the United States, Canada, and the United Kingdom. The series was co-produced by TV3 and Sreda of Russia. Janson signed the deal with Moscow-based film distribution company Central Partnership (a division of Gazprom-Media Holding).

Gogol, a limited television series of eight one-hour episodes, is an historical adventure detective story inspired by the life and novels of the famous 19th century writer Nikolai Gogol. Gogol was one of the leading figures the natural school of Russian literary realism, and the author of the classic novel, Taras Bulba. The series stars Alexander Petrov (T-34, Ice) and Oleg Menshikov (Attraction). In Russia, Gogol premiered on TV3.

The Amazon Prime Video release will be the first digital run of the Gogol television series in a foreign language, however, the Gogol project as a whole is already well-known to the international audience. Gogol won the People’s Choice Award at Biografilm Festival (Italy) and the prize for Outstanding Cinematography at the Accolade Global Film Competition Festival (USA). Hollywood Director John Woo selected Gogol as the Best Foreign TV Series at The Indie Gathering International Film Festival (USA). The composer of the project Ryan Otter won a prestigious international music award for Gogol at the Global Music Awards (USA). Also, the Gogol trilogy of feature films has been released in theaters in Germany, the UK, Austria, Belgium, Switzerland, Cyprus and UAE.
